Local Massachusetts Honey

Massachusetts offers a rich environment for beekeeping and honey production, thanks to its blend of coastal lowlands, forested hills, and fertile farmland. The state’s distinct seasons provide bees with a progression of nectar sources—spring blooms like apple and cherry blossoms give way to summer wildflowers and clover, followed by fall’s goldenrod and asters. The temperate climate, with warm summers and cold winters, supports active foraging during the growing season, while the state’s rural pockets and suburban gardens ensure diverse floral options. Massachusetts’ long agricultural history and growing interest in local, sustainable food bolster a vibrant beekeeping scene, producing honey that reflects its varied landscapes.

What kind of Honey is produced in Massachusetts?

While Massachusetts doesn’t claim a wholly unique honey, its wildflower honey is the primary type, celebrated for capturing the state’s seasonal floral diversity. This honey ranges from light and delicate, with notes of fruit blossoms and clover, to deeper, earthier tones from late-season wildflowers like goldenrod. In some regions, beekeepers produce small batches of single-source honeys, such as cranberry honey from the Cape Cod bogs, where bees pollinate cranberry blossoms in summer, yielding a subtly tart, amber-hued treat. Wildflower honey, however, remains the mainstay, offering a taste of Massachusetts’ fields and forests in raw, unfiltered form.
